Mexico - Domestic Consumption of Olive Oil
Since 2015, Mexico Domestic Consumption of Olive Oil was up 1.9% year on year. With 22 Thousand Metric Tons in 2020, the country was number 17 comparing other countries in Domestic Consumption of Olive Oil. Mexico is overtaken by Lebanon, which was ranked number 16 at 23 Thousand Metric Tons and is followed by South Korea with 21 Thousand Metric Tons. United States lead the ranking with 386 Thousand Metric Tons in 2020, a decrease of 4.9% versus 2019. Turkey, Morocco and Brazil resp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Saudi Arabia recorded the best 5 years average growth at +12.3% per year, while Syria was the worst growing country at -4.6% per year.
